Don Miller A quorum (3 or more) present the following action was taken by the committee: 1. Discussed the claim from Don Miller. Don felt the settlement offer of $350 is inadequate -- total bills come to a little over $600.00. Mr. Miller explained what happened regarding the sewer backup, which caused the damage. Further discussion. It was recommended that the committee contact Richard Sayler, the adjuster, for reconsideration of the settlement amount. 2. Discussed the possibility of going out for bid on the City's insurance coverages. It has been 3 years since we have done this. Williams Agency will give us an estimate of possible increases on our current policies by the first week in February, and it will be determined at that time if we should go out for bids. 3. Discussed going out for bid on Health insurance. Don will contact Becky Hewitt.of Blue Cross to get a usage report. Respectfully submitted, Ji_ -- Donald L. MONTANA 59104 (406) 245-2903 SUITE 202-A 1601 LEWIS AVE- December 20, 1983 Mr. Don Miller 413 Wyoming Avenue Laurel, Montana 59044 Dear Mr. Miller, Enclosed herewith is a property damage release form releasing the City of Laurel.in the amount of $350. We are providing you with this consideration for damages occurring to your property on December 3, 1983. We are offering this consideration so as to conclude a doubtful and disputed claim. This offer is not an admission of guilt or an admission of liability, but is made to buy our peace so as to conclude the claim you have made a.-ainst the City of Laurel. If you can somehow verify what caused the sanitary sewer at Laurel, • Montana to back up, or be blocked up, please advise. Then, perhaps we can go to the person or persons who caused the line to back up and request payment from them. This offer is made without prejudice. Thank you for your cooperation and may we hear from you soon. I have explained and advised both Mr. Larry Peterson,.director of public works at Laurel, Montana of this offer, and also have advised the in- surance agent Mrs. Olivia Lee of the Williams Agency of said offer to buy our peace. I am enclosing a self addressed stamped envelope for your con- venience in replying and forwarding the property damage release to us by return mail so as this matter can be brought to a conclusion as mentioned above.
